A car is essential for almost everyone in Bouldercombe, where every single home owns at least one motor vehicle. This heavy reliance on driving is seen in the daily commute, with nearly 70% of workers driving themselves to work.

Vehicles

Motor vehicles per home, and homes with no car.

Every household in Bouldercombe has a motor vehicle, a figure well below the national average of 7.4% without one. Most homes have two cars, while 11.8% of households own four or more.

In Bouldercombe, the largest group is 2 vehicles at 43%, followed by 1 vehicle (23%) and 3 vehicles (22%).

Getting to work

How people travel to work.

Only 6.2% of people work from home, which is far below the Australian figure of 21.0%. Public transport use is a little below the state average at 1.3%, though this has risen slightly since 2011.
